Пример #2
0
struct spi_ep *ep_new_pkt(struct spi_source *source, spi_epaddr_t epa,
	const struct timeval *ts, void *data, uint32_t size)
{
	struct spi *spi = source->spi;
	struct spi_ep *ep;
	char *key;
	struct spi_pkt *pkt;
	mmatic *mm;

	key = _k(source, epa);
	ep = thash_get(spi->eps, key);
	if (!ep) {
		mm = mmatic_create();
		ep = mmatic_zalloc(mm, sizeof *ep);
		ep->mm = mm;
		ep->source = source;
		ep->epa = epa;
		thash_set(spi->eps, key, ep);

		source->eps++;

		dbg(8, "new ep %s\n", spi_epa2a(epa));
	}

	/* make packet */
	pkt = mmatic_zalloc(ep->mm, sizeof *pkt);
	pkt->size = size;
	pkt->payload = mmatic_zalloc(ep->mm, spi->options.N);
	memcpy(pkt->payload, data, spi->options.N);
	memcpy(&pkt->ts, ts, sizeof(struct timeval));

	/* update last packet time */
	memcpy(&ep->last, ts, sizeof(struct timeval));

	/* store packet */
	if (!ep->pkts)
		ep->pkts = tlist_create(mmatic_free, ep->mm);

	tlist_push(ep->pkts, pkt);

	/* generate event if pkts big enough */
	if (ep->gclock1 == 0 && tlist_count(ep->pkts) >= spi->options.C) {
		ep->gclock1++;
		spi_announce(spi, "endpointPacketsReady", 0, ep, false);
		dbg(7, "ep %s ready\n", spi_epa2a(epa));
	}

	return ep;
}
